Output 3058d59286aefe2748d6ddb2f2f7a1fdc0bc997263bff1733a5425dd2d54d077:0

value
104880436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24b02abd4b070861060f9632fe43dc74f32eb4fc OP_EQUAL
address
MBF9bdWydRAhGF4dmy7bhrXUg6C8zi8k3w
transaction
3058d59286aefe2748d6ddb2f2f7a1fdc0bc997263bff1733a5425dd2d54d077
spent
true